Ingredients
-
1 (4 pound) beef brisket, trimmed of fat
-
salt to taste
-
1 large onion, sliced
-
1 (12 fluid ounce) can beer
-
1 tablespoon brown sugar
-
1 cube beef bouillon
-
2 tablespoons coarsely ground black pepper
-
2 teaspoons minced garlic
-
1 bay leaf
-
¼ teaspoon dried thyme
-
2 tablespoons cornstarch
-
2 tablespoons water
Directions
-
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
-
Season brisket with salt and place in a baking dish. Cover entire roast with onion slices.
-
In a medium bowl, mix together the beer, brown sugar, beef bouillon, pepper, garlic, bay leaf, and thyme. Pour over the roast. Cover with aluminum foil.
-
Bake for 4 hours in the preheated oven. The brisket should be fork-tender.
-
Mix together cornstarch and water; stir into the juices in the baking dish to thicken. Remove the bay leaf. Slice and serve brisket.
